- likely to be the case or to happen可能发生的; 或然的:
it is probable that the economic situation will deteriorate further
经济形势可能会进一步恶化
the probable consequences of his action.
他的行为可能导致的后果。
1
- a person who is likely to become or do something, especially one who is likely to be chosen for a team有希望入选的人(尤指成为队员):
Merson and Wright are probables.
默森和赖特很有希望成为队员。
2
- an aircraft recorded as likely to have been shot down可能已被击落的飞机。
词源
late Middle English (in the sense 'worthy of belief'): via Old French from Latin probabilis,from probare 'to test,demonstrate'.
